它给了我错误
将“char”传递给“const char*”类型的参数时,整数到指针转换不兼容;当我尝试编译程序时,它出现在第 36 行。
我该如何修复它?
#include <cs50.h>
#include <ctype.h>
#include <math.h>
#include <stdio.h>
#include <string.h>
int main(int argc, string argv[])
{
string pt = get_string("plaintext: ");
int len = strlen(pt);
string ct;;
string key = argv[1];
int lenkey = strlen(key);
if (lenkey < 26)
{
printf("Key must contain 26 characters.");
}
else if (argc > 2)
{
printf("Usage: ./substitution key");
}
else if (argc < 2)
{
printf("Usage: ./substitution key");
}
string keyu;
string keyl;
// Key of uppercase
for (int i = 0; i < 26; i++)
{
if (isupper(key[i]))
{
keyu = strcat(keyu, key[i]);
}
else if (islower(key[i]))
{
keyu = strcat(keyu, toupper(key[i]));
}
}
// key of lowercase
for (int i = 0; i < 26; i++)
{
if (islower(key[i]))
{
keyl = strcat(keyl, key[i]);
}
else if (isupper(key[i]))
{
keyl = strcat(keyl, toupper(key[i]));
}
}
// create cyphertext
for (int i = 0; i < len; i++)
{
if (islower(pt[i]))
{
ct = strcat(ct, keyl[pt[i] - 97]);
}
else if (isupper(pt[i]))
{
ct = strcat(ct, keyu[pt[i] - 65]);
}
else
{
ct = strcat(ct, pt[i]);
}
}
}
以下是程序的重构版本,它基于加密密钥构建单词的加密版本。
#include <ctype.h>
#include <stdio.h>
#include <string.h>
int main(int argc, char *argv[]) /* Usual declaration with input parameters */
{
if (argc != 2)
{
printf("Usage: ./substitution key\n");
return 1;
}
char ct[30], pt[30], key[30], keyl[30], keyu[30]; /* Strings are character arrays */
int len;
//string pt = get_string("plaintext: ");
printf("plaintext: "); /* Common method to prompt for input */
len = scanf("%s", pt);
len = strlen(pt);
//string ct;;
//string key = argv[1];
strcpy(key, argv[1]); /* Common string copy method */
int lenkey = strlen(key);
if (lenkey < 26)
{
printf("Key must contain 26 characters.");
return 2;
}
//string keyu;
//string keyl;
// Key of uppercase
for (int i = 0; i < 26; i++) /* Simply store uppercase versions of the characters */
{
keyu[i] = toupper(key[i]);
}
// key of lowercase
for (int i = 0; i < 26; i++) /* Simply store lowercase versions of the characters */
{
keyl[i] = tolower(key[i]);
}
// create cyphertext
for (int i = 0; i < len; i++)
{
if (islower(pt[i]))
{
ct[i] = keyl[pt[i] - 97];
}
else if (isupper(pt[i]))
{
ct[i] = keyu[pt[i] - 65];
}
else
{
ct[i] = pt[i];
}
}
printf("cypher text: %s\n", ct);
return 0;
}

craig@Vera:~/C_Programs/Console/Substitution/bin/Release$ ./Substitution zyxwvytsrqponmlkjihgfedcba
plaintext: checkers
cypher text: xsvxpvih
craig@Vera:~/C_Programs/Console/Substitution/bin/Release$ ./Substitution zyxwvytsrqponmlkjihgfedcba
plaintext: xsvxpvih
cypher text: checkers
craig@Vera:~/C_Programs/Console/Substitution/bin/Release$ ./Substitution Hello there
Usage: ./substitution key
craig@Vera:~/C_Programs/Console/Substitution/bin/Release$
我绝没有诋毁“CS50”支持库和文件的意思。在学习中使用您认为合适的功能。但是,当您评估其他来源的代码时,您可能会看到字符数组定义和其他变量定义等项目更有可能采用这种常见格式。因此,您也希望能够适应以这种方式构建的代码。
